On 10/28/22 19:30, Thierry Reding wrote: > On Fri, Oct 28, 2022 at 12:07:38PM +0100, Jon Hunter wrote: >> On 28/10/2022 10:25, Jon Hunter wrote: >>> On 28/10/2022 03:19, Krzysztof Kozlowski wrote: >>>> On 25/10/2022 04:02, Wayne Chang wrote: >>>>>>> + power-domain-names: >>>>>>> + items: >>>>>>> + - const: xusb_host >>>>>>> + - const: xusb_ss >>>>>> Drop 'xusb_'. >>>>> The properties are constant and we use the name to get the power domain. >>>>> >>>>> tegra->genpd_dev_host = dev_pm_domain_attach_by_name(dev, >>>>> "xusb_host"); >>>>> >>>>> tegra->genpd_dev_ss = dev_pm_domain_attach_by_name(dev, "xusb_ss"); >>>>> >>>>> we might not be able to drop the xusb_ >>>> These are new bindings, so why do say they are "constant"? New bindings >>>> means you did not use them. If you used them before bindings... what can >>>> we say? Don't? >>> Not exactly. However, what we should do here is convert the legacy >>> binding doc [0] and replace with this one. But yes we are stuck with the >>> 'xusb_host' naming. >> >> Thierry already has a patch to do this [0]. So we should fix that up and >> included in this series. >> >> Jon >> >> [0]https://lore.kernel.org/linux-tegra/20211209165339.614498-3-thierry.reding@xxxxxxxxx/ > I have a v2 with at least some of the comments addressed. I'll go > through them again and send it out. If we can get that reviewed, it can > be included in this series and the Tegra234 addition be applied on top. Thanks for the help, Thierry. I'll update the binding after your change got updated. > > Thierry thanks, Wayne.